What is a Testing Framework?
A testing framework consists of a set of tools that help the developer to test their written code in an automated environment. The testing framework should have the following features:
- The most important is the ability to automatically execute the tests easily.
- It should display the results of the tests in an easy-to-understand way.
- Best practices for writing efficient and organized test cases.
Top 5 JavaScript Testing Frameworks
JavaScript is the most popular programming language for frontend development and day by day the popularity is increasing. In this modern world, almost every web app is built using JavaScript. As we are stepping towards the modern era of automation with the immense popularity of JavaScript the need for robust and efficient JavaScript testing frameworks is increasing.
These are the Top 5 JavaScript Testing Frameworks:
Table of Content
- Mocha
- Jest
- Karma
- Jasmine
- Puppeteer